Abstract

Myelin is multi-layer lipid membrane that surrounds and insulates axons, which is synthesized by oligodendrocyte (OL) in the central nervous system. OLs develop from neural stem cells. Researchers found that many transcription factors, such as Olig2, Sox10, Nkx2.2, Olig1 and Zfp218, play very important roles in the process of OL differentiation, development and maturation. Myelin formation is effected by multiple signaling pathways, including Wnt, PI3K, BMP-Smad signaling pathway. The process of OL differentiation, development and myelination is highly regulated. Here, we mainly review the recent advance in axon surface ligands, transcription factors, epigenetics and other relevant factors for myelination.
